WebNov 10, 2024 · A FET consists of a p-type and n-type silicon bar containing two PN junctions at the sides. The bar forms the conducting channel for the charge carriers. When the bar FET is of n-type, it is called n-channel FET and when the bar of FET is of p-type, it is called p-channel FET. ca form 540nr booklet https://katfriesen.com

For now, we have an idea that there is no PN junction present between gate and channel in this, unlike a FET. We can also observe that, the diffused channel N (between two N+ regions), the insulating dielectric SiO 2 and the aluminum metal layer of the gate together form a parallel plate capacitor.

WebThis places the depletion-type, or simply D-type, IGFET in a category of its own in the transistor world. Bipolar junction transistors are normally-off devices: with no base current, they block any current from going through the collector. Junction field-effect transistors are normally-on devices: with zero applied gate-to-source voltage, they ...
